Wheel of Fortune Slots Enhanced with a New Video and Special Bonuses

The Wheel of Fortune Slots, which are based the television game show “Wheel of Fortune”, one of the most popular game shows ever on television, were a big hit the minute they were introduced to the playing public.  Now, IGT, the slot machine’s manufacturer, is launching several new versions of the game complete with video and special bonuses.

The new video slot, IGT’s “Special Edition”, is sure to attract a lot of players with its upgraded graphics, enhanced stereo sound, and actual video clips of TV show hosts Pat Sajak and Vanna White guiding players through the action of the game.  No doubt, the new features only serve to distract players from the fact that they are really still playing with just an ordinary slot machine. The slots are five-reel, fifteen-line games allowing bets of up to 75 coins per spin.

The new bonus round features included with the new Wheel of Fortune slots include the Triple Action Wheel.  With the regular slots, players that got a bonus round were allowed to spin the wheel again and whatever slot number the wheel landed on was multiplied by whatever the player’s bet was (in other words, if the wheel landed on a five the player received five times her bet, if the wheel landed on a ten, the player would receive ten time her bet etc).  With the new game, the player is given the opportunity to solve actual word puzzles associated with red, yellow, and blue pointers above the wheel. If the player gets all three correct, she will then get all three multipliers that the pointers landed on.

Money Spin is the other bonus feature appearing with the new Wheel of Fortune slots.  With this bonus a player can spin the wheel and either get a bonus slot and continue as usual or she might get a bonus amount and a second spin of the wheel to add to her winnings.  If the player is really lucky, she might receive the bonus and launch a completely separate version of the game that features six reels, four rows, and twenty pay lines.   In this version of the game, players can really see the money come in.
